Meet Winnie, she's between 1 and 2 years old, 9.5 pounds, and full of spunk. Winnie can be quite the party girl, but she can also entertain herself during quiet time. She gets along with other dogs and is curious about her foster parent's grandson.
Winnie just arrived in rescue so we are still learning about her. Her mom's first story is about discovering the toy basket.
Winnie loves toys and managed to completely empty the basket and place them all in her bed. If you believe "toy hoarding" is redeeming value, Winnie just might be your girl. Winnie is also crate trained and working on her house training skills.
